The files handed down to the offices of the Kosovo Liberation Army Veterans Organisation, which are alleged to be documents of specialised Chambers of the Special Court, according to lawyers, have damaged credibility in this court, but the image of Kosovo.

While the lawyer, Arian Koci, said that with the release of these documents, credibility could lose Kosovo on the international level, even though for domestic consumption it might seem attractive, on the other hand, the Kerinni said that trust in the Special Court has fluctuated.

“Somebody can seem to have damaged the credibility of the Special Court, but I believe the opposite will happen -- Kosovo's credibility will be harmed. In fact, for internal consumption, this one might look attractive, but we plan the international plan does not make a good impression on all that's happening. This situation suits supporters of the idea that protected witness” are threatened in Kosovo, Koci has said.

And according to Krkin, the credibility of this court should be expected to see whether those documents will be used for criminal proceedings.

Qerkey said the Special Court cannot make decisions based on documents produced in Serbia, given this state's stance on Kosovo.

“Yes, but it is expected to be seen that this evidence, which KLA veterans own, will be used for criminal proceedings or not. If used for criminal proceedings, then I really consider that the court processes cannot be considered creditable, because the position of the Serbian state is known against Kosovo, and therefore we cannot say that the Serbian state has produced credit documents, in which the court can support its actions or decisions,”, Kerkeyni said.

According to Koci, the biggest losers in this process will be the potential indictees of this court, while he said that in this case the KLA's OVL is manipulated.

“E know that a court of foreign judges and prosecutors has been established, with foreign investigators and administrative staff. Even translators are foreigners. This is unacceptable to me. There's a special war going on against the Special Court for reasons I don't know. The OVL in this case is manipulated. In fact, the biggest losers will be potential indictees”, Koci said.

Meanwhile, as far as publishing these documents are concerned, the lawyer, Kerkin, has said that if documents are published that are classified by the Special Court, then this is a criminal offense.

On the other hand, Qerkeyni explained that such an act is not considered a criminal offence if the documents are classified by the Serbian prosecution, as listing documents by the Serbian prosecution does not impose on anyone in Kosovo.

We need to be clear here, we're forbidden to publish documents that are classified, but the labeling of those documents should make the Specialised Chambers or Prosecutor's Office. But if these documents are classified as secret by the Serbian prosecution, this classification does not owe anyone in Kosovo. If we are dealing with protected witnesses, his statement is classified, and his identity is classified”, Qerkey said.

Koci also said he has instructed all those who have asked him not to publish the names of witnesses, as it is a criminal offence, and that, as Koci said, the last war is a fact that the Serbian state has committed crimes, and that this battle must be won in court.

Every reporter who asked me was instructed that in no way be published the names of witnesses because it's a criminal offense. Moreover, in the last war, it is notary fact that the former Serbian power has committed war crimes in Kosovo. Therefore, we will do the battle and win it where it should be: in court”, Koci said.

Otherwise, for about three weeks, the KLA's OVL has accepted several documents, claiming to have anything to do with the Special War Crimes Court in Kosovo. The contents of these documents are not clear and are not known if they are original.

The identity of the person, who, according to the OVL, has sent to this organisation <x0 thousand witness files and witness names”, continues to be anonymous.
